本文目录导读:
在当今数字化时代,门户网站已经成为企业和组织展示自我、服务客户的重要窗口,本文将深入探讨门户网站的源码设计理念、功能模块以及实现方式,为读者提供一个全面而深入的视角。
随着互联网技术的飞速发展,门户网站作为信息传播和服务的核心载体,其重要性日益凸显,从新闻资讯到电子商务,从社交互动到在线教育,门户网站几乎涵盖了人们生活的方方面面,如何构建一个高效、灵活且用户体验良好的门户网站,成为摆在开发者面前的一个重要课题。
图片来源于网络,如有侵权联系删除
门户网站的功能模块设计
-
首页设计:
首页是门户网站的的脸面,需要具备吸引用户眼球的设计元素和丰富的信息展示能力,在设计时,可以考虑采用网格布局、瀑布流等现代设计手法,使页面既美观又实用。
-
频道分类导航:
不同的频道对应着不同的内容和功能,如新闻、财经、娱乐、科技等,通过清晰的分类导航,可以让用户快速找到自己感兴趣的内容区域。
-
内容管理系统(CMS):
CMS 是门户网站的核心组成部分之一,负责内容的创建、编辑、发布和管理,一个好的 CMS 应该具有易用性、可扩展性和安全性等特点。
-
搜索功能:
搜索是门户网站不可或缺的一部分,可以帮助用户在海量信息中快速定位所需内容,在设计搜索框时,应考虑关键词建议、历史记录等功能,提升用户的搜索体验。
-
会员中心:
对于一些需要注册登录才能使用的功能或资源,可以通过会员中心来实现,会员中心可以包含个人信息管理、积分兑换、消息通知等功能模块。
-
广告投放系统:
广告是门户网站重要的收入来源之一,通过合理的广告位规划和精准的广告投放策略,可以提高广告的效果和收益。
-
统计分析工具:
图片来源于网络,如有侵权联系删除
为了了解网站的使用情况和优化方向,可以使用统计分析工具来收集和分析各种数据指标,如访问量、跳出率、转化率等。
门户网站的技术选型与实现
-
前端技术栈:
前端技术的发展日新月异,HTML5、CSS3、JavaScript 等新标准的引入使得网页开发更加便捷和高效,Vue.js、React.js 等前端框架也为构建复杂的应用提供了强大的支持。
-
后端技术栈:
后端主要负责数据的处理和存储,常用的技术包括Java、Python、PHP 等,在选择后端技术时,应根据项目的具体需求和技术团队的熟悉程度进行综合考虑。
-
数据库选择:
数据库的选择对于门户网站的性能和稳定性至关重要,常见的数据库有MySQL、PostgreSQL、MongoDB 等,在选择数据库时,需要考虑读写性能、并发控制、备份恢复等因素。
-
缓存机制:
缓存是一种有效的加速手段,可以有效减轻服务器压力和提高响应速度,常用的缓存技术包括Redis、Memcached 等。
-
安全防护:
在线安全形势日益严峻,门户网站必须采取一系列的安全措施来保护用户数据和隐私不受侵害,这包括但不限于SSL加密、防篡改检测、DDoS攻击防御等。
构建一个优秀的门户网站需要综合考虑多个方面的因素,从功能模块的设计到技术的选型与实现,每一个环节都紧密相连、缺一不可,只有不断学习和探索新技术和新方法,才能跟上时代的步伐,满足用户的需求变化,让我们携手共进,共同打造更多优质高效的门户网站!
标签: #门户 网站源码
评论列表